Donadel: Juventus Goal Was Offside

Fiorentina midfielder Marco Donadel believes that his side deserved all three points against Juventus and slams the decision of the referee to allow Vincenzo Iaquinta's goal to stand.

Adrian Mutu scored an 88th minute equaliser at the Stadio Artemio Franchi to earn the Viola a 1-1 draw against Juventus.

Vincenzo Iaquinta had opened the scoring for the Bianconeri in the 23rd minute with a controversial goal. A defensive misunderstanding involving Alessandro Gamberini and Dario Dainelli allowed Iaquinta to curl the ball past Sebastien Frey from the edge of the area.

However David Trezeguet was standing in an offside position and appeared to be impairing Frey's view of the shot. The goal was allowed to stand, and although there was little complaint from Fiorentina players at the time of the incident, Donadel has hit out after the game.

"It's embarassing to concede a goal like we did. Trezeguet was offside and their were two other penalty incidents for us that the referee did not whistle for," fumed Donadel.

"Juventus are a difficult team to play against and we were a little tired but we managed to make the scores even.

"We deserved to win this game and the draw almost feels like a defeat."

Fiorentina drop one place to fourth after today's match but they are still unbeaten in Serie A with three wins and four draws from their seven games.
